I figured it out. Its not using your video card at all. All of the graphics are being rendered by your cpu. I ran the game with msi afterburner displaying all of the GPU info, like core voltage, temperature and gpu ultilization. No change from browsing here. Normally there should be a huge spike in all of theses. Nothing. This is a major problem. Its running in "software" mode and not "hardware" if anybody remembers older games. Thats the problem.
